A robot vacuum can keep floors clean enough to reduce the frequency with which you'll need to manually vacuum. Find one that has good navigation, can clean stairs and corners and also has a large dust bin that needs emptying only every few times.
There are also models that mop and charge on their own, a feature that may be beneficial for those with children or pets. A lot of the top performers in our tests have good obstacle avoidance.
1. IRobot Roomba i3+ EVO
The i3+ EVO and its i3 EVO sibling the i3 EVO, are identical robots that differ only in that the i3+ has self-emptying capabilities. The i3+ is a great alternative for those who want a an automated, hands-free cleaning experience, but want to manually empty the budget robot vacuum's dustbin after it has filled up.
Both robots are adept in removing dirt and dust particles on floors and carpets and are able to navigate around furniture and other obstacles. iAdapt navigation software creates smart maps of your home that help the i3+ EVO to navigate and clean in a manner that maximizes efficiency. However, unlike the i7+ and other top-rated robots we test, the i3+ doesn't have obstacle-avoidance capabilities, so it may be stuck on things like socks or power cords, and it may have trouble navigating across surface transitions like from hardwood to carpet.
iRobot suggests that you clear areas where the i3+ EVO will vacuum prior to when you use it, which includes clearing out any toys or clutter it might encounter. It is also recommended to keep the filters and dust bin clear to avoid getting blocked. If the i3+ EVO's internal bin is full or its battery is low it will return to its docking station, automatically empties its debris into the station's dust bin, and then continues cleaning where it started. The battery's lifespan is around an hour-and-a-half of continuous use. It takes about three hours to charge.
2. Roomba by iRobot
The iRobot i7+ is the top model in iRobot's flagship line, and it comes with the latest features. It's self-charging and self-navigating. However, the most important feature is the self-emptying bin. This removes the need for regular maintenance.
The Roomba i7+ is able to remember up to 10 floor plans and their names thanks to Imprint Smart Mapping, a system that lets it create maps of rooms so that it can clean them more efficiently. It also works with the iRobot Home app to let you schedule cleaning tasks and direct your robot by voice or through the app.
The i7+ is more efficient and more maneuverable in our tests than the eufy RoboVac G30. It also cleaned large pet hair pieces from any surface including carpeting. The main advantage it has over the Eufy is its self-emptying bin which removes major maintenance sources and reduces recurring cost.
We were also impressed by the i7+'s integration with Amazon Alexa and Google Assistant AI services that we used to instruct the robot vacuum ebay to begin, stop or pause its cleaning routines and move around the room and sweep an area. The iRobot Home App made it easy to connect the i7+ to these services. After connecting we were able to give the i7+ voice commands, such as "Hey Alexa, vacuum the master bedroom." The iRobot Home App also offers options to manage i7+ settings and monitoring performance.
3. Dyson Cyclone V10
This tiny Dyson model is an all-sports car in a world of vacuums powered by cordless that resemble minivans and buses. It has the power and features to replace a stand-up vacuum in the majority of households however, it can also fit perfectly next to the coffee table or a bookshelf where you can move it around like an enchanted tool.
The V10 is powered by a 7-cell, energy-dense lithium-ion battery that produces energy that is not faded for 60 minutes. Its advanced whole-machine filtration system removes allergens, and then releases cleaner air back into your home. The specially designed head utilizes stiff nylon bristles to drive deep into carpets and pick up large particles or fine dust. It has three different suction modes that can be adjusted to suit the task. It can quickly change from handheld to floor vacuum and vice versa.
This model also has an accessory dock that can charge to 100% in about 3.5 hours and provides easy access to two attachments and a Wand clip. This is a big improvement over earlier Dysons, that require a long charge and are a pain to store.
The V10's main drawback is its limited running time. The claims of its marketing that it has up to 60 minutes of running time are a bit misleading as CR's tests show. This is an average and not a remarkable run time for a battery-powered cordless vac. This is still enough to get rid of the majority of a home that's average size but not long enough to cover every spot (though a second run-through usually will suffice). This model has its own advantages however: it's light and more maneuverable than older Dysons cordless models and its ability to vacuum is significantly better on carpets with low pile.
4. iRobot Roomba 694
The 694 is a standard robot vacuum that's an excellent choice for those who don't have lots of money to invest in a robot. It was able to remove all kinds of debris in our tests and would often go over the same area several times to ensure an efficient clean. Its flat front makes it possible to reach the corners and the edges of walls.
Its intelligent navigation system makes use of iAdapt to avoid obstacles and navigate your home, but it's not equipped with the ability to map that comes with more sophisticated models such as our top picks, the i3+ EVO and the j7+ series. Because of this, it is sometimes stuck on things like phone cords and furniture that isn't as sturdy, and frequently will run out of battery before returning to its base.
The Xiaomi Mi robot vacuum is superior to the Roomba 694 in most respects, as it has fewer components that require regular maintenance It also comes with an allergen-trapping HEPA filter, has lower recurring costs, comes with more advanced automation capabilities and is better at maneuvering itself. It also has a larger dustbin and charges quicker.
The RoboVac X8 is a slick RoboVac X8 is superior to the Roomba 694 for a variety of purposes, because it has a better battery life, has the ability to alter the suction power mode by hand and has physical boundary strips, and can be controlled by your smartphone's voice assistant. It is also more robust, has a larger motor, and performs better on floors with bare or low-pile.
5. Samsung Jet Bot AI+
Samsung is a well-known brand in home electronics. It's no surprise, then, that they are one of the top makers of robot vacuums and mop. Their Jet Bot AI+ is equipped with cutting-edge onboard technology to aid in navigation and obstacle avoidance.
The app provides a range of options for customizing your robotic cleaner. These include virtual barriers, mopping levels and behavior customizations docking frequency settings and more. It's simple to comprehend and is user-friendly, which is the case with other Samsung devices.
In our testing of the Jet Bot AI+ excelled on hard floors, and also handled dog hair (on carpet) quite well, clearing up 86% of it. It did not do well in avoiding taller items such as cords or socks. This was disappointing. It's also a bit more expensive than the other models we've tested and could be a problem for some buyers.
The smart vacuum comes with an onboard camera that is accessible via the app, and you can also create a live stream from the robot's cleaning station. This feature lets you monitor your pets or kids when you're away from home. The filter and dustbin are washable for quick, painless cleanup. The Jet Bot AI+ also comes with a clean station that self-empties to keep the robot's dustbin clear and optimizes suction power for each cleaning run.
